Internet Explorer 6.0 Customers
If you have recently upgraded your web browser to Internet Explorer 6.0, you may experience problems with our store locator - the store locator may display only blank pages with a "page 2" or other buttons at the bottom.
Our store locator system uses "session cookies" which stores the zip code you enter into the temporary memory of your computer. It remains in memory until your browser's window is closed and does not write any permanent information to your computer.
Since our store locator relies on this type of memory, your computer must have the session cookies enabled. During most upgrades or installations of Internet Explorer 6.0 this type of cookie automatically gets turned off. As a result, some types of websites, including our store locator, that rely on this type of cookie will not appear to work properly on your computer.
It is an easy process to turn these back on. Please follow the simple steps below.
1. On your Internet Explorer browser window, click the "Tools" menu and then select "Internet Options." A gray window will appear.
2. Click the "Security" tab, then click on the "Internet" icon (a picture of a globe) and then click the "Custom Level" button at the bottom.
3. In the window that appears, scroll down to the "Cookies" section and then to the "Allow per-session cookies (not stored)" subsection. Click the option button next to "Enable" which will turn on the session cookies, vice the defaulted "Disable" option.
4. Click "OK."
5. When prompted, "Do you want to save the security settings for this zone?" click "Yes."
6. Click "OK" again to close the window.
Once these steps have been completed, close your browser window and re-open it and then try the store locator again.
